+2015-11-24  Andreas Schwab  <schwab@suse.de>
+
+       [BZ #17062]
+       * posix/fnmatch_loop.c (FCT): Rerrange loop for skipping over rest
+       of a bracket expr not to run off the end of the string.
+       * posix/Makefile (tests): Add tst-fnmatch3.
+       * posix/tst-fnmatch3.c: New file.

+#include <fnmatch.h>
+
+int
+do_test (void)
+{
+  const char *pattern = "[[:alpha:]'[:alpha:]\0]";
+
+  return fnmatch (pattern, "a", 0) != FNM_NOMATCH;
+}
+
+#define TEST_FUNCTION do_test ()
+#include "../test-skeleton.c"
